Output 27fc6ffa345ae0581a6b6319c3d591c9663271b521a2dda310f674c24b8e70f2:40

value
478511
script pubkey
OP_0 OP_PUSHBYTES_20 158ed8243f8ecf3990528b0de7ee94d3ceea8263
address
bc1qzk8dsfpl3m8nnyzj3vx70m55608w4qnr8cj0dg
transaction
27fc6ffa345ae0581a6b6319c3d591c9663271b521a2dda310f674c24b8e70f2